📝 How to Start a Blog: A Complete Beginner’s Guide

In today’s digital world, starting a blog is one of the best ways to share your ideas, build an audience, and even make money online 💻. Whether you’re passionate about travel ✈️, food 🍕, tech 🤖, or personal development 📚—blogging gives you the platform to express yourself and connect with people all over the globe 🌍.

If you’ve ever thought, “I want to start a blog but don’t know how,” this guide is for you. Let’s break it down step by step so you can start your blogging journey with confidence 💪.

✅ Step 1: Choose a Niche

Your niche is the topic or theme of your blog. Picking the right niche is super important 🔍. Ask yourself:

  • What am I passionate about? ❤️
  • What can I write about consistently? 🧠
  • Is there an audience for this topic? 👥
  • Can I eventually monetize this niche? 💰

Popular niches include:

  • Health & fitness 🏋️‍♂️
  • Travel 🧳
  • Food & recipes 🍰
  • Personal finance 💵
  • Tech & gadgets 🔌
  • Self-improvement 🌱

Choose a niche that you won’t get tired of writing about!

🌐 Step 2: Pick a Blogging Platform

Now, you need a place to build your blog. The most popular blogging platform is WordPress.org (not to be confused with WordPress.com). It’s free, flexible, and easy to use.

Other options include:

  • Wix 🧱
  • Squarespace 🔲
  • Blogger 📝
  • Medium 📖

But if you’re serious about blogging and want full control, WordPress.org is the best option 💯.

💻 Step 3: Get a Domain and Hosting

To make your blog live on the internet, you need:

  • Domain Name: This is your blog’s address🌐
  • Web Hosting: This is where your blog lives online 💾

Some popular and affordable hosting providers are:

  • Bluehost 💙
  • Hostinger 🔥
  • SiteGround 🛠️

Choose a plan, register your domain, and connect it to WordPress.

🎨 Step 4: Design Your Blog

Now comes the fun part—designing your blog! 🖌️

Pick a clean, responsive theme that looks good on both desktop and mobile devices 📱. You can choose free themes from WordPress or buy premium themes from sites like:

  • ThemeForest 🌲
  • Elegant Themes 🎩
  • Astra 🚀

Customize your header, logo, menus, and layout to reflect your style.

Pro tip: Keep it simple and focus on readability. Users should easily find what they’re looking for 🧭.

✍️ Step 5: Write and Publish Your First Blog Post

It’s time to write your first post! Here’s a simple structure you can follow:

  1. Catchy Title – Make it clear and engaging 🎯
  2. Introduction – Hook the reader and set the tone 📢
  3. Body – Share your main points, tips, or story 🧾
  4. Conclusion – Wrap up and include a call to action (CTA) 🧩

Use headings, bullet points, and images to break up the text and make it easier to read 👓.

Remember, done is better than perfect. Just hit publish! 🖱️

🔎 Step 6: Promote Your Blog

Once your blog is live, it’s time to spread the word 📢. Promote your content on:

  • Social media (Instagram, Facebook, Twitter, LinkedIn) 📱
  • Pinterest (great for lifestyle, food, and fashion blogs) 📌
  • Email marketing (build a subscriber list early!) 📧
  • SEO (Search Engine Optimization) – use keywords to help people find you on Google 🔍

The more you promote, the more traffic your blog will get!

💰 Step 7: Monetize Your Blog

Yes, you can make money blogging! 💸 Once you build an audience, consider these monetization options:

  • Ads (Google AdSense) 🖼️
  • Affiliate marketing (promoting other people’s products and earning a commission) 🔗
  • Sponsored posts 📑
  • Selling your own products or services (like eBooks, courses, consulting) 🛍️
  • Memberships or subscriptions 🎟️

But don’t rush. Focus on providing value first, and the income will follow 💼.

🎯 Final Thoughts

Starting a blog might seem overwhelming at first, but it’s actually simple when you follow the steps:

  1. Choose your niche
  2. Pick a platform
  3. Get hosting and a domain
  4. Design your blog
  5. Write awesome content
  6. Promote your posts
  7. Monetize when ready

Be consistent, be patient, and most importantly—have fun with it! 🎉

Remember, every big blogger started with zero readers. Keep writing, keep learning, and your blog will grow over time 🌱.

Happy blogging! ✨🖊️

Post navigation

6 Comments

Leave a Reply to DealerShadow Cancel reply

Your email address will not be published. Required fields are marked *